If your uPVC window doesn't close properly, it could be because of gaps between the frame and the sash. This problem may not just cause draughts, it can also result in water damage and damp. To check this, try putting a piece paper between the frame and the sash to see if it is able to be closed.

To repair it, you'll have to take off the seals around the frame and the sash. You will then need to remove the locking mechanism from its position inside the frame. This will require the assistance of a tool like a flat screwdriver as well as a torch to reach the gearbox. After removing the gearbox, you will need to replace with one that is similar in size and shape.

Repairing the window frame of UPVC

If your uPVC windows are damaged, have cracks or holes, or a broken window seal, it's important to fix the problem as soon as you notice it. These problems can cause the glass to fog, and can also lead to water leaks. Furthermore, the frame damage can decrease the insulation value of your home, which can result in higher energy bills. Most of these problems are easily fixed by a professional or a DIY repair.

UPVC window repair is more cost-effective than replacing the entire window, but there are situations where it's more beneficial to replace the entire window. This is especially true if the frame is damaged beyond repair. There are many aspects that affect the cost of UPVC window replacement, including the type of material used and the amount of work required. A complete replacement will cost between $100 and $1000 per window, and the cost will vary based on the extent of the damage and whether replacement is required.

Cleaning UPVC windows is important to prevent dirt and moisture buildup. You will avoid expensive repairs in the future. You should do this at least twice every year. You could also use WD-40 to grease the moving parts of your UPVC window. It is best to employ a soft brush in order to get rid of any cobwebs and dust from the frame prior to cleaning it. Window frame replacement with UPVC

UPVC windows are an excellent option for homeowners due their durability, low maintenance requirements, and excellent insulation properties. However, they are susceptible to a range of issues that may require professional repair. Common problems are cracked or leaking seals, window sills and window sash issues and damaged handles, hinges and locking systems. These problems can affect the aesthetics and functionality of your home if not addressed promptly. UPVC window specialists can resolve these issues, making sure your uPVC windows are secure and functional.

During an inspection of your windows, a professional will be able identify any concerns and provide you with advice on the best way to proceed for your specific situation. You will also receive a full estimate for any repairs you require. The typical repair for the frame of a UPVC window will require taking out the frame and sash as well as cleaning the sill and jambs, and replacing the old sealing materials with new ones. The cost of repair will vary based on the type of window you own and the condition of it.

A leaking UPVC can be caused by many factors, such as weather conditions or general wear and wear and tear. These elements can cause the UPVC window to sag or be damaged. The damage could be costly to repair, which is why it is essential to find a qualified specialist to do the job.

The condensation of water between the glass panes is another common issue with double-glazed UPVC Windows. This can happen when the window frames are not fitted correctly, or if the nails fins are loose and do not create a solid seal. A specialist in uPVC will replace the seals to ensure that the window is properly sealed to prevent drafts. This will increase the efficiency of the window and stop drafts.
